📊 Company Overview

AXT, Inc. (NASDAQ: AXTI) is a Fremont, California-based semiconductor materials company that sits at the very heart of the AI infrastructure buildout:

  • Market Cap: ~$3.8–$4.4B (post-April 2026 offering)
  • Industry: Semiconductor Materials & Equipment
  • Current Price: ~$78–$79 (April 30, 2026 intraday; 52-week range: $1.23–$90.10)
  • Primary Business: Indium phosphide (InP), gallium arsenide (GaAs), and germanium (Ge) substrate wafers — the physical raw material that makes silicon photonics transceivers and AI optical interconnects possible
  • 3-Month Performance: +290%+ — one of the best-performing semiconductor stocks in the US in 2026
  • Key Fact: AXT manufactures through its Beijing-based subsidiary Tongmei, making it both a critical supply-chain link AND a geopolitical headline risk

According to Semiconductor-Today, AXT ranks among the top-five InP substrate suppliers globally — a group that controls roughly 70% of global InP wafer revenue. With a ~70% global InP supply/demand gap reported by TrendForce, this is one of the few real supply squeezes in the AI stack right now.

China Gallium/Germanium Export Suspension — Active Through November 27, 2026

China's November 2025 suspension of the gallium/germanium export prohibition runs through November 27, 2026 per Fastmarkets. This cleared the biggest near-term overhang for AXT's GaAs and Ge product lines. However, the clock is ticking — a re-imposition would directly impact two of AXT's three core substrate businesses.

InP Supply/Demand Gap — Structural Tailwind

TrendForce reports a ~70% global InP supply/demand gap — 1.4M piece demand vs 600K production capacity in 2025. NVIDIA's Quantum-X/Spectrum-X silicon-photonics switches use 18 silicon-photonics engines per unit, all dependent on InP laser chips per TrendForce. AXT sits directly in the supply bottleneck for the hottest build-out in tech.

Tongmei STAR Market IPO — Wild Card

The Tongmei subsidiary IPO on Shanghai's STAR Market has been under CSRC review since August 2022 per AXT's 10-K SEC filing. Management continues to say "coming months" — it has slipped every deadline since 2022. If approved, it would be a valuation re-rating event since Tongmei produces 100% of AXT's wafer output. But do not underwrite this as a 2026 certainty.

⚠️ Risk Catalysts (Negative)

Analyst Price Targets Are Well Below Spot

Wedbush raised its price target from $8.50 to $28 and Northland raised to $35 — the consensus PT of ~$35.60 is materially BELOW the ~$78 spot price. Analysts are still catching up to the AI-photonics thesis rather than leading it. That means the stock is running ahead of fundamental coverage, which is both a sign of institutional conviction AND a warning that any bad print faces an air pocket with no analyst support underneath.

Competition: 6-Inch InP Fab Broke Ground in March 2026

TrendForce reported the world's first 6-inch InP photonic-chip industrial wafer fab broke ground in March 2026. AXT dominates in 4-inch today — if the industry transitions to 6-inch before AXT's expansion completes, their competitive position could erode faster than the capacity doubling can offset it.

About AXT, Inc.: AXT, Inc. designs, develops, manufactures, and distributes high-performance compound semiconductor substrate wafers — primarily indium phosphide (InP), gallium arsenide (GaAs), and germanium (Ge) — through its majority-owned Beijing-based subsidiary Tongmei. The company is a top-five global supplier of InP substrates and sits at the material foundation of the AI silicon-photonics supply chain, with a market cap of approximately $3.8–$4.4 billion in the Semiconductor Materials & Equipment industry.
